Virginia Marie O"Steen, 84, of St. Augustine, Fla., died May 25, 2010, at her home. She was born in Pittsburgh, on Dec. 11, 1925, and had resided in St. Augustine since 1945. She and her late husband, Robert V. O"Steen, were the founders of O"Steen"s Restaurant.
Memorial services will be held at 3 p.m. Friday at Craig Funeral Home Chapel. Flowers are gratefully declined, and those wishing may make a contribution in her memory to Bailey Center for Caring, c/o Community Hospice, 4266 Sunbeam Road, Jacksonville, FL 32257.
She is survived by her daughter, Karen O"Steen; two grandchildren, Erin Murrah and Keely Murrah; and one great-grandson, Noah Murrah.
She has been blessed with The Girls, Tara Ganson, Penny Angelus (Billy), and Trixy Pacetti (Chuck) and their children, Jerry Sanders, Stefan Sanders, John Ganson, Crystal Pacetti, Christian Pacetti and Rory Angelus, all of St. Augustine, Fla.
Craig Funeral Home Crematory Memorial Park is in charge of the arrangements.

To The O'steen family: It was around 1970 or '71 and I will always remember Mrs. O'steen being kind and friendly to a young 14 year old boy that would walk across AIA in the evenings from his grocery baggging job at the old J&L Food Banner to buy and snack on two of the best hush puppies in the south. She would always slip in either a third or a couple of shrimp and tell me to be sure to tell my parents hello. I have great memory's of growing up in my hometown and Mrs.O'steen is a part of all those great moments. All my prayers to your family during this time.
